From bae87b0877db1e0d14491ec4b4f28500b3b2d2dd Mon Sep 17 00:00:00 2001 From: Alfred Wingate Date: Tue, 14 Nov 2023 20:31:36 +0200 Subject: [PATCH] Fix euscan by using portage MetadataXML over gentoolkit Metadata Signed-off-by: Alfred Wingate --- src/euscan/handlers/__init__.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/euscan/handlers/__init__.py b/src/euscan/handlers/__init__.py index 8ee02b3..0393bce 100644 --- a/src/euscan/handlers/__init__.py +++ b/src/euscan/handlers/__init__.py @@ -4,7 +4,7 @@ import pkgutil from euscan import CONFIG, output -from gentoolkit.metadata import MetaData +from portage.xml.metadata import MetaDataXML handlers = {'package': [], 'url': [], 'all': {}} @@ -64,7 +64,7 @@ def get_metadata(pkg): try: if os.path.exists(meta_override): - pkg_metadata = MetaData(meta_override) + pkg_metadata = MetaDataXML(meta_override) output.einfo('Using custom metadata: %s' % meta_override) if not pkg_metadata: pkg_metadata = pkg.metadata